Description Ian 2009-08-31 17:13:41 UTC
Version:            (using KDE 4.3.0)
OS:                Linux
Installed from:    Ubuntu Packages

If I resize the panel at the bottom of my screen (click the cashew and drag the 'height' slider), then toggle compositing off (shift-alt-F12), the panel resizes back to its default height.

I can reproduce this any time I like. However, it only happens if I make the panel shorter than the default height; if I make the panel higher than the default size it doesn't get changed when I toggle compositing.

Comment 3 Christoph Feck 2009-09-30 11:41:35 UTC
I can confirm this is fixed in trunk, and according to bug 184905, it has been backported, so it will be in 4.3.2. An earlier commit had been reverted, so the fix is not in previous 4.3 versions.
